KAL & Fujitsu Collaborate on IFX Solution

 

Fujitsu and KAL Collaborate in IFX-SOAP/XML Solution for Banking ATMs

Tokyo, October 31, 2002-Fujitsu Limited and KAL today announced that they are jointly developing a banking ATM (Automated Teller Machine) solution based on the new IFX protocol. The solution will consist of an OEM application developed by KAL for the ATM side and an ATM switch server solution developed by Fujitsu. IFX (the Interactive Financial eXchange Forum) is the emerging open standard protocol for communication between ATMs and ATM switches, based on advanced XML technology and SOAP-HTTP transport. A consortium of companies representing a cross-section of the banking and information systems industries is developing the IFX standard. Fujitsu is the first Japanese ATM manufacturer to join the forum. The goal of the IFX consortium is to replace the myriad of proprietary protocols with a single web-based open standard in order to greatly simplify development and support of financial transactions.

Fujitsu and KAL joined forces for this project in Japan earlier this year, and their development team includes some of the premier specialists in the ATM, XML and EAI fields. The companies' joint solution has been developed based on the newly released (September 23, 2002) IFX 1.0 SOAP Implementation Document, using a truly open architecture including the use of advanced XML technology and SOAP over HTTP. In addition, the implementation of Fujitsu and KAL's IFX-SOAP/XML solution is expected to lead to a new generation of flexible application architectures that simplify the addition of new financial and non-financial services to the ATM environment and for a variety of business sectors.

The new solution uses Fujitsu's advanced XML technology, including its powerful, top-selling EAI software, Interstage CollaborationRing (UNIX/Win), as an IFX-SOAP/XML ATM Switch Server to connect to the ATM via IFX-SOAP/XML for messaging and data format exchange. Fujitsu's 8000 Series ATM is used for the ATM hardware platform, and is based on KAL's flagship Kalignite middleware product and new OEM application for IFX. Further details and a demonstration of the IFX-SOAP/XML solution will be made at the upcoming BAI Retail Delivery Conference & Expo 2002, the world's premier financial retail delivery show, to be held November 4 - 7, 2002 in Atlanta, USA.

The retail banking industry demands efficient, secure authentication and payment systems using web-based technologies. However, current legacy mechanisms were not designed to support emerging web-based applications and IP-based connectivity. These factors suggest that the IFX-based solution will become highly popular in the financial industry, and Fujitsu and KAL, both world leaders in open ATM systems, see this as an important step toward its widespread adoption.

About KAL

KAL is the world-leading provider of open software for Automated Teller Machines (ATMs) and self-service systems. KAL's flagship product is Kalignite. More than 70 applications have been developed using the Kalignite system and it is running on more than 8000 self-service systems worldwide. Kalignite enables the creation of web-enabled, hardware independent self-service and branch-banking applications built upon acknowledged standards such as XFS. It is a world-class development platform upon which complete solutions can be readily developed for ATMs (Automated Teller Machines), kiosks and all other types of self-service systems as well as branch-banking applications.
